gpio_irq_api.h
00001 /* mbed Microcontroller Library 00002 * Copyright (c) 2006-2013 ARM Limited 00003 * 00004 * Licensed under the Apache License, Version 2.0 (the "License"); 00005 * you may not use this file except in compliance with the License. 00006 * You may obtain a copy of the License at 00007 * 00008 * http://www.apache.org/licenses/LICENSE-2.0 00009 * 00010 * Unless required by applicable law or agreed to in writing, software 00011 * distributed under the License is distributed on an "AS IS" BASIS, 00012 *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. 00013 * See the License for the specific language governing permissions and 00014 * limitations under the License. 00015 */ 00016 #ifndef MBED_GPIO_IRQ_API_H 00017 #define MBED_GPIO_IRQ_API_H 00018 00019 #include "device.h" 00020 00021 #if DEVICE_INTERRUPTIN 00022 00023 #ifdef __cplusplus 00024 extern "C" { 00025 #endif 00026 00027 /** GPIO IRQ events 00028 */ 00029 typedef enum { 00030 IRQ_NONE, 00031 IRQ_RISE, 00032 IRQ_FALL 00033 } gpio_irq_event; 00034 00035 /** GPIO IRQ HAL structure. gpio_irq_s is declared in the target's HAL 00036 */ 00037 typedef struct gpio_irq_s gpio_irq_t; 00038 00039 typedef void (*gpio_irq_handler)(uint32_t id, gpio_irq_event event); 00040 00041 /** 00042 * \defgroup hal_gpioirq GPIO IRQ HAL functions 00043 * @{ 00044 */ 00045 00046 /** Initialize the GPIO IRQ pin 00047 * 00048 * @param obj The GPIO object to initialize 00049 * @param pin The GPIO pin name 00050 * @param handler The handler to be attached to GPIO IRQ 00051 * @param id The object ID (id != 0, 0 is reserved) 00052 * @return -1 if pin is NC, 0 otherwise 00053 */ 00054 int gpio_irq_init(gpio_irq_t *obj, PinName pin, gpio_irq_handler handler, uint32_t id); 00055 00056 /** Release the GPIO IRQ PIN 00057 * 00058 * @param obj The gpio object 00059 */ 00060 void gpio_irq_free(gpio_irq_t *obj); 00061 00062 /** Enable/disable pin IRQ event 00063 * 00064 * @param obj The GPIO object 00065 * @param event The GPIO IRQ event 00066 * @param enable The enable flag 00067 */ 00068 void gpio_irq_set(gpio_irq_t *obj, gpio_irq_event event, uint32_t enable); 00069 00070 /** Enable GPIO IRQ 00071 * 00072 * This is target dependent, as it might enable the entire port or just a pin 00073 * @param obj The GPIO object 00074 */ 00075 void gpio_irq_enable(gpio_irq_t *obj); 00076 00077 /** Disable GPIO IRQ 00078 * 00079 * This is target dependent, as it might disable the entire port or just a pin 00080 * @param obj The GPIO object 00081 */ 00082 void gpio_irq_disable(gpio_irq_t *obj); 00083 00084 /**@}*/ 00085 00086 #ifdef __cplusplus 00087 } 00088 #endif 00089 00090 #endif 00091 00092 #endif
